Week 13 Recap: Tuesday Edition
Jaguars Rallies to Beat jwolf920, Undefeated in the Series
- Updated: Tuesday December 03, 2024 11:44:02 AM CUT
- Share
Jaguars clinches a spot in the playoffs after taking down jwolf920 again, this time by a final score of 120.80 to 115.60. Their record improves to 9-4, while jwolf920 falls to 6-7. jwolf920 isn't an easy win for Jaguars, who now has an average margin of victory of 9.63 points in the series, a lot smaller than their season average. Joe Mixon (101 Rsh Yds, 1 TD) was the winning factor this week, putting up 21.90 points. The last time these teams met, Chuba Hubbard led the way with 22.10. If jwolf920 didn't have both J.K. Dobbins and Romeo Doubs put up zeroes, things could have been different.
There was one player on Jaguars that missed out on opportunities. Despite being targeted seven times, Zay Flowers could manage just three catches.
It wasn't all bad news for jwolf920, as they did put together a team of real-life winners. Every starter except Tua Tagovailoa played on a victorious NFL team this week. While Bo Nix led Jaguars weeks (with 19.42 points), Mixon has now been the team's top scorer in two of the last three matches.
Jaguars meets T Ds n BEER (5-8, 1,510.10) in Week 14. jwolf920 plays Johnny Lujack (6-7, 1,443.86).
